Not exactly. Mute has a different purpose than a volume control. How the HTML5 media element works might be a good example of this.

audio.volume = 1 --> Sound is playing
audio.volume = 0 --> Sound not playing
audio.volume = 1 --> Sound playing
audio.muted = true --> Sound not playing
audio.volume = 1 --> Sound still not playing
audio.muted = false --> Sound playing

Whether something is muted, and whether it has zero volume is different.

Youtube makes it seem like they're the same since when you drag the volume to zero it looks the same as muted, but you can still click the volume icon to mute/unmute. And they still have the extra icon with the X next to it.

I just learned you can stack icons: http://fortawesome.github.io/Font-Awesome/examples/#stacked

<div class="fa-stack">
  <i class="fa fa-volume-off fa-stack-1x"></i>
  <i class="fa fa-ban fa-stack-1x"></i>
</div>

which gives the following two examples (one is hovered as red):
